Chapter 18
~Koji's POV~
I wanted so much to faint right there. Every single part of my body burned as if it was being cremated.
But I can't give up. Everyone's depending on me. If I give up, Zoe will never have a chance of being free. I have to go on, for her sake, and everyone else's.
I hate this.
"How pathetic," An evil voice laughed.
That is got to be Cherubimon
"Cherubimon," Ophanimon confirmed my guess. "So you are here."
"Nice to see you again Ophanimon," The villain shown himself.
"I cannot say the same."
"Have I done anything to displease you?" He chuckled mockingly.
"You know very well of the evil you did."
"I don't call it evil. I call it noble."
"Noble you call it?" Koichi stood up. "I, call it crap."
"Well, if it isn't the little traitor Koichi," Cherubimon narrowed his eyes.
"My brother is not a traitor!" I rejected.
"Are you sure? The next thing you know he might be stabbing your back, like Zoe." He answered amusingly.
"Shut, up." I said, cold fury rose within me, and I clenched my fist tightly around my sword.
JetSilphymon rushed up to me and began to attack.
"Jet Turbulence." Over and over again she struck me with her jets, changed from her wings. I was too busy to defend to notice my pains.
"Zoe, please I don't want to fight you," I called, when I finally found a break.
"I do." She replied merely.
"But we're your friend!"
"Yeah, what Koji said." JP yelled from behind.
"I do not have or need friends," after her final reply, she elevated her staff and a shadowy light came up. "Kaze no Kazu."
Right away, before I could even think what to do, a gust of indescribable darkness swiped in. But instead of attacking me, it was heading towards the others.
"No!" If that hits them, Cherubimon will be able to suck up their data. I can't let him.
I ran across to in front of them just in time to block the attack. The weight of it crashed down on me. I couldn't hold on any longer.
I felt myself weakening and slipping away as I became human again, and my data was outside, clear and shining.
The daylight was too bright for me. Amongst all the blurriness I could still clearly see JetSilphymon walking towards me.
This cannot be the end for us. There must be something we can do.
"What can we do?" A voice said in my head. "There's no hope, might as well give up."
While I was busy arguing with my head, JetSilphymon was already over me. I saw her claw coming my way.
I closed my eyes and breathed my last breath. Maybe I was meant to die in this world.
